Sanju Samson To Lead Rajasthan Royals In Crucial IPL 2024 Eliminator Against RCB
Sanju Samson will be leading Rajasthan Royals as they take on Royal Challengers Bengaluru in the IPL 2024 Eliminator on Wednesday (May 22).
The Royals have been struggling with a five-match winless run. They will have to turn things around at the Narendra Modi Stadium as a defeat would end their IPL campaign in a hugely underwhelming fashion.

Jos Buttler's departure hasn't helped their cause, but captain Sanju Samson will have to step up and lead from the front. He has been in excellent touch this IPL season, which also earned the RR captain a spot in the India squad for the T20 World Cup.
Samson has already amassed 504 runs in this IPL season. The Rajasthan skipper has scored 5 fifties this year and is batting at a strike rate of 156.
As the Royals face the Challengers in a crucial match, onus will be on Sanju Samson to deliver his best with the bat.
Sanju Samson has amassed 4392 runs in 165 IPL matches at an average of 30.93. He has scored 25 fifties and 3 centuries over the years. Samson is one of the seven batters with more than 500 runs in this IPL season.
Sanju Samson's record against RCB in the IPL over the years is quite underwhelming. The RR skipper has scored 452 runs in 22 matches against RCB so far, with an average of 21.52. He has scored three fifties against them.
But Samson has found scoring difficult against RCB. His last eight scores before this season against RCB were lower than 30, but the Rajasthan skipper scored a fantastic 69 runs off 42 balls in the most recent match against RCB.
